How to Identify Tickets Closed Without an Assigned Cash Drawer

The Payment List Report can be used to locate tickets that were closed based on specific payment and cash drawer parameters.

  1. Navigate to the Payment List Report.
  2. Select the desired Date Range.
  3. Select the applicable Payment Type(s).
  4. Select the Cash Drawer and Shift to view all payments closed under those selected parameters.. 
  

To view payments that were closed without an assigned cash drawer:
  1. Select the desired Date Range.
  2. Select the applicable Payment Type(s).
  3. Leave the Cash Drawer filter unselected to view all payments closed within the selected date range and payment type.
  4. Select the Cash Drawer filter and choose the option indicating No Cash Drawer Assigned.

  


This will allow you to identify specific ticket numbers that were closed without being associated with a cash drawer.

Once you have located the ticket number that was not closed under an assigned cash drawer:
  1. Confirm that a cash drawer is currently assigned to your checkout screen.
  2. Reopen the ticket.
  3. Update the payment method, if needed.
  4. Reclose the ticket.

After the ticket is reclosed, it will be associated with the assigned cash drawer.



Alert
Important: the Reopen Ticket permission enabled is required to reopen tickets. Visit Setup Worker Permission Glossary for more details.
WarningNote: If the original payment was processed using an integrated payment method (this does not include manual payments) and the ticket is later reopened, the integrated payment cannot be removed or edited. To close the reopened ticket and remove it from the Checkout List, you must complete the checkout using a different payment method, such as No Sale, if no additional payment is due.
